A Novel Trackbed Material for Stiffness Transition in Bridge Approaches and Its Integration in Educational Outreach

The objective of this study is to develop a prototype 'stiffness transition' trackbed material and evaluate its engineering properties with laboratory tests. A self-compacting semi-flexible composite material (SFCM) will be developed for easy track modulus adjustment under different stiffness transition scenarios determined from the 3D dynamic track 'Sandwich Model'. Controlling the modulus of trackbed with customizable engineering properties can reduce dynamic loading impact to both highway and bridge structures, and lead to increased life and improved safety of track components.
